    How drastic is the transition from the front straight onto the infield portion of the track?

    If you hit the entry and exit of the front stretch just right (as you will see on on the early laps you do) its not too bad at all. If I remember correctly, don't do either of these at too much of angle or you'll it will upset the bike more than you might want. The transition off the BACKstretch is a bit a of jar though, and some were taking their butt off the seat to help there.

    On late and Off early..... Its not bad at all. When you come out of the last turn though your instincts tell you to get up on the wall and pin it... I stay down on the Black as long as possible.. Its smoother and you dont lose any time. Same goes for the backside too however diving into the infield back there you cant be too low... After a few laps you will have it figured out...
